Continuous Integration and Continuous Delivery
Continuous integration and continuous delivery are fundamental components of DevOps. Continuous integration enables developers to frequently merge code changes into shared repositories where automated builds and tests can validate them. Continuous delivery helps organizations automate the process of preparing software for deployment. These practices reduce manual intervention, identify defects earlier, and allow organizations to deliver application updates more frequently and consistently.

Infrastructure as Code
Infrastructure as Code allows organizations to manage infrastructure through configuration files rather than relying on manual provisioning. This approach enables development and operations teams to create repeatable and consistent infrastructure environments. It also makes infrastructure changes easier to track, test, and reproduce. By incorporating Infrastructure as Code into DevOps workflows, organizations can improve deployment reliability and reduce infrastructure management complexity.
Containerization and Kubernetes
Containers provide a consistent environment for packaging and running applications across development, testing, and production environments. Technologies such as Docker and Kubernetes have become important components of modern DevOps architectures. DevSecOps and Security
Security should be integrated throughout the software development lifecycle rather than addressed only after applications are deployed. DevSecOps incorporates security testing, vulnerability scanning, access controls, compliance checks, and other security practices into development and deployment workflows. Automated Testing
Software quality is essential for reliable application delivery. Automated testing allows organizations to validate application functionality continuously throughout the development lifecycle. Unit testing, integration testing, performance testing, security testing, and end-to-end testing can be incorporated into automated pipelines. This helps teams detect defects earlier and reduce the risk of releasing unstable applications.
